Peppermint documentary to be produced by Elliot Page

Since first debuting in the ninth season of RuPaul’s Drag Race, Peppermint has become a figurehead for LGBTQ+ activism, particularly campaigning for trans rights. Now, her life is being celebrated on the big screen. 

“A Deeper Love: The Story of Miss Peppermint” will cover the performer’s early career and provide viewers a personal and in-depth look at her rise to stardom.

Actor Elliot Page and his production company, Pageboy Productions, are helping bring the doc to life. In an interview, Page praised Peppermint’s journey as “powerful, urgent, and deeply human.” 

“Her artistry, courage, and advocacy have changed the landscape for trans performers and inspired so many of us,” he added. “This documentary captures the full complexity of her experience in a way that feels both intimate and universal.”

 

 

The documentary comes at a crucial and uncertain time for the transgender community. From issuing an executive order restricting access to gender-affirming care to changing transgender passport holders to gender markers to those assigned at birth, the Trump administration’s attacks on transgender people have been detrimental. 

Peppermint has dedicated her life not only to her craft but also to advocating for transgender issues similar to these.  

Speaking to the Hollywood Reporter, Peppermint said she was “thrilled” the documentary was ready to roll after “nearly a decade of work.”

“Trans issues are in the zeitgeist, yet our full humanity is so often left out of the conversation,” she said. “This film aims to offer something different—something more honest and personal.”

 The film is set to premiere at Framline49 in San Francisco on 26 June.
